This program is one of our affordable 12 for 12 for 12 programs (12 weeks of study, 12 credits, for $12,000). Imagine studying the European and global challenges that Germany faces then walking along the remnants of the Berlin Wall, a stark reminder of the city’s turbulent past. Or wandering through the Turkish Market while learning about migration in Germany. Our International Affairs & Security Studies Program provides just this. Courses in this program take advantage of Berlin’s position as Germany’s capital and Germany’s position as a leading state in the European Union. The English-taught courses compare and contrast the pros and cons of the European Union’s open borders, of strategies to combat terrorism, and of the challenges and benefits that migration brings.

Fell in love with Berlin and I miss it every day
March 25, 2022by: Corena Pincham - United StatesProgram: IES Abroad Berlin – Security Studies & International AffairsI had an incredible time studying abroad in Germany, and I have the utmost regard for IES's Berlin Center. I felt so welcomed from day one, and the bond I developed with others in the program has warmed my heart. My classes around European affairs and international politics were always intriguing, and I got to understand Berlin's history better through them. Understanding the immense transformation the city has undergone since the 20th century was a humbling and eye-opening experience, especially as an American. We went on excursions to Potsdam, Hamburg and Dresden, and I spent fall break in Munich! The neighborhoods our student apartments and study center are in were very enjoyable and safe, and public transportation was always accessible. I had many opportunities inside and outside of class to understand the plethora of cultures represented in Berlin as well as interact with people from all over the world. This experience was enriching for my studies in International Affairs, and I got to advance my language skills with bi-weekly formal instruction and everyday interactions. The application process was straightforward and I felt adequately prepared by IES in the lead-up to our arrival. I gained much personal growth over these 3 1/2 months, from adapting to a different cultural context and navigating in a new geography to embracing persistence and engaging in public diplomacy. Even in a pandemic, I wouldn't change a single aspect of this experience.

September 11, 2017by: Darren - United StatesProgram: IES Abroad Berlin – Security Studies & International AffairsI studied abroad in Berlin, Germany the Spring Semester of 2017. I had an amazing time. IES Abroad really did a great job of integrating me into the city. We learned about the culture of the city through a comprehensive orientation. The program introduced us to Berlin locals, further integrating us into the city. As a student I got to partake in European Union panels, an experience I would have otherwise not had without IES. The classes weren't that difficult, but furthered our appreciation of the city with many field trips. I found my own living situation, but most seemed to enjoy their living situation.
